Description
A rich and creamy Southern style crockpot mac and cheese made with classic cheeses and slow-cooked for deep, comforting flavor.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 cups elbow macaroni
- 2 cups shredded sharp cheddar cheese
- 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
- 1 cup evaporated milk
- 1 cup whole milk
- 4 tbsp unsalted butter
- 2 large eggs
- 1 tsp salt
- 1/2 tsp black pepper
- Optional: paprika or garlic powder
Instructions
1. Cook macaroni until al dente and drain
2. Grease crockpot lightly
3. Add macaroni and cheeses
4. Whisk milk and eggs together
5. Pour mixture over pasta
6. Add butter and seasoning
7. Cook on low for 2.5 to 3 hours
8. Stir once or twice gently
9. Serve warm and creamy
Notes
- Do not overcook pasta
- Add milk if texture thickens too much
- Use sharp cheddar for stronger flavor
- Optional broil for crispy top
- Store leftovers up to 3 days
